Understanding Roblox: What Exactly Is It?
Roblox isn’t just a game; it’s a platform where users can create, share, and play games created by other users. Think of it as a giant, user-generated gaming universe. Players can explore a vast library of games, interact with others, and customize their avatars. This open-ended nature is a key part of its appeal, but it also presents a complex set of considerations for parents.

Potential Risks: What Parents Need to Know
While Roblox offers many positive aspects, it’s crucial to be aware of the potential risks:
- Inappropriate Content: Since the games are user-generated, some content may be unsuitable for children. This can include violent themes, suggestive content, and content that violates Roblox’s terms of service.
- Cyberbullying and Harassment: Online interactions can sometimes lead to bullying, harassment, and unwanted attention.
- Predatory Behavior: Predators may use the platform to target children. This is a serious concern that parents need to be vigilant about.
- Privacy Concerns: Sharing personal information, even inadvertently, can compromise a child’s privacy.
- In-App Purchases and Spending: Roblox uses in-app purchases (Robux) to enhance gameplay, which can lead to excessive spending if not monitored.
- Exposure to Scams: Children can be vulnerable to scams and phishing attempts within the platform.
Setting Up Safety Measures: Parental Controls and Settings
Roblox provides several parental controls that can significantly enhance your child’s safety:
- Account Restrictions: You can restrict who your child can chat with, friend, and send messages to.
- Content Filtering: Roblox offers filters that attempt to block inappropriate content.
- Spending Limits: Set spending limits to control the amount of Robux your child can purchase.
- Two-Step Verification: Enabling two-step verification adds an extra layer of security to your child’s account.
- Reporting and Blocking: Teach your child how to report inappropriate behavior and block users.

Roblox’s Content Moderation: How Does It Work?
Roblox employs a combination of automated systems and human moderators to monitor content. While the platform strives to remove inappropriate content, it’s not always perfect. Understanding the limitations of content moderation is essential. The user-generated nature of the platform means that some inappropriate content may slip through the cracks. Roblox’s goal is to provide a safe experience; however, parents should still actively monitor their child’s activity.
Managing In-App Purchases: Preventing Unwanted Spending
In-app purchases in Roblox can quickly add up. Here’s how to manage them effectively:
- Set a Budget: Discuss a budget with your child for Robux purchases and stick to it.
- Use Parental Controls: Utilize the spending limits feature in Roblox to restrict how much your child can spend.
- Require Permission: Require your child to ask for permission before making any purchases.
- Monitor Purchase History: Regularly review the purchase history to ensure there are no unauthorized transactions.
- Consider Alternatives: Explore free games or activities within Roblox to reduce the need for in-app purchases.

Can I completely prevent my child from encountering inappropriate content?
While you can take significant steps to reduce the risk, it’s impossible to guarantee that your child will never encounter inappropriate content on Roblox. The platform’s vastness makes complete prevention challenging. However, consistent monitoring, open communication, and the use of parental controls can minimize the exposure.
How do I know if my child is being cyberbullied?
Look for changes in your child’s behavior, such as reluctance to use Roblox, increased anxiety or withdrawal, or secretive online activity. Talk to your child, ask direct questions, and pay attention to their emotional state. If you suspect cyberbullying, document any evidence and report it to Roblox and, if necessary, law enforcement.
What if my child encounters a stranger asking for personal information?
Immediately instruct your child to stop communicating with the stranger and to block them. Explain the dangers of sharing personal information online. Report the incident to Roblox and consider discussing it with your child’s school or other trusted adults.

What happens if my child breaks Roblox’s rules?
Consequences for breaking Roblox’s rules can vary depending on the severity of the violation. They can range from temporary suspensions to permanent account bans. Roblox also has a reporting system that players can use to alert the platform of violations.
